WebWhat is the age limit for Major Junior Hockey? Players can play until they are 20 years old. As long as they do not turn 21 prior to the start of the season, you’re still eligible for the CHL, or Major Junior. CJHL – Canadien Junior Hockey League (Junior “A”) What is the age …

Web9 de abr. de 2024 · After players are selected for the B team, players are then selected for the C team. This is considered to be the next group of most competitive players for the given age division within the association. All divisions U11-U15 are two year age groups, with U18 being a three year age group. WebJunior hockey is a level of competitive ice hockey generally for players between 16 and 21 years of age. Junior hockey leagues in the United States and Canada are considered amateur (with some exceptions) and operate within regions of each country.. In Canada, the highest level is major junior, and is governed by the Canadian Hockey League, which …
